There are two versions of Skyr. There is the "yogurt" version that you eat. Then there is skyr.is  which is a frozen yogurt like drink. Siggi's skyr can be found in the states but I don't think the other version is here... Yet. I make my own using plain skyr and adding my own fruits, cream and then freezing it.
